Output 166e8e4e25573f1654b5470ef3c08453fff9a9a130366ee546d9c91bec54be56:5

value
101206
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14933ac26afbdaecdb6ec77285e751c6f9105270 OP_EQUAL
address
33Zop4rvYvkEXTVbAdFJgiLH75EB3Fu1p5
transaction
166e8e4e25573f1654b5470ef3c08453fff9a9a130366ee546d9c91bec54be56
spent
true